What defines a dark video game?
Dark video games typically feature themes of horror, violence, and complex emotional narratives that challenge the player’s perspective. -
Are all dark-themed games horror games?
Not necessarily, while many dark games fall within the horror genre, others may be dramatic or narrative-driven titles that explore tough themes. -
